Regen On Purpose
Regen on Purpose is a podcast for leaders who sense that sustainability alone isn’t enough.
Hosted by Karen Gray, the podcast explores what it really takes to move from sustainability to regeneration designing and delivering systems that become healthier over time.
Drawing on three decades of experience in delivery leadership, people development, and transformation, each episode looks at why change often struggles to hold, and how leadership decisions, delivery choices, and learning environments shape long-term outcomes.
This is a space for thoughtful conversations about building what lasts for people, organisations, and the planet without hype, jargon, or quick fixes.

Green on Purpose — Season 1 Overview
Green on Purpose is a leadership podcast hosted by Karen Gray, exploring regenerative leadership, delivery, and how leaders build long-term value.
Season 1 sets the foundation.
This season explores what it means to move beyond traditional transformation and sustainability — and into regeneration: leadership and delivery designed to strengthen people, systems, and outcomes over time.
Rather than a collection of isolated episodes, Season 1 is structured as a coherent journey. It begins by grounding regeneration in everyday delivery decisions, expands into systems leadership and real-world practice, and then moves into measurement, impact, AI-enabled judgement, and the future of purpose-led delivery.
What Season 1 Covers
Across the season, we explore:
- Why regeneration is changing how leaders define success
- How everyday delivery decisions compound into long-term outcomes
- The role of people, place, and environment in leadership and wellbeing
- Moving from intention into practical, repeatable leadership habits
- Organisations as living systems — and how to design for resilience
- Real-world examples of regeneration in action
- Measuring contribution, not just performance
- Impact mapping, handprints, and designing positive value
- Common myths about regenerative leadership — and what actually works
- AI as a decision-support partner, not just an automation tool
- Moving from ESG compliance to embedded regeneration
- How regenerative thinking reshapes priorities, portfolios, and pace
- Designing for long-term value in high-pressure environments
- The future of purpose-led delivery as a core leadership capability
